Transaction 29d9659656cc75b03fcab3a18c9d46c7de89dab8e18b19baa355e51d9bf51f95
1 Input
1 Output
-
29d9659656cc75b03fcab3a18c9d46c7de89dab8e18b19baa355e51d9bf51f95:0
- value
- 105834
- script pubkey
- OP_0 OP_PUSHBYTES_20 98aa6c8ce408da638661bdfbcb053ed48e6f1b90
- address
- bc1qnz4xer8yprdx8pnphhaukpf76j8x7xus8hjh20